What your child develops
How Do I Become Human Again is a compact, earnest platformer made by a solo developer for a game jam. Despite its small scope, it offers genuine cognitive benefits for younger players: navigating falling and moving platforms exercises spatial awareness, hand-eye coordination, and quick reaction time. The level-based structure provides mild escalating challenge, encouraging persistence and basic problem-solving as players learn platform timing. The light science-fiction premise — a robot reclaiming its stolen DNA — adds a small layer of thematic curiosity and could spark conversations about identity and technology.

About this game
This game was made for "game jam confinement": Title: How I become human again Team: @Piwy Technology: Unity (C#) Presentation: How I become human again is a simple platform game where you play as a robot that has to collect its DNA that scientists have removed from it in order to perform an experiment. Assets: To make this game, I used these differents assets: Standard Asset from Unity: The robot is a character available for free in the Unity asset store and more precisely in "Standard asset", created by Unity.
